For now, visit the ‘virtual’ farmers market

Although the seasonal Ellijay Farmers Market on Broad Street is not open during the current coronavirus “shelter in place” shutdown, there is a way for local residents to visit the popular Saturday morning venue.

“We are working on doing a ‘virtual’ Ellijay Farmers Market, which will be explained on the Ellijay Farmers Market Facebook page and on the Gilmer County Master Gardener Extension Volunteers website,” said Margaret Williamson of the gardeners.

Although it was hoped the market would be open by May 13 — Gov. Brian Kemp’s latest date for relieving COVID-19 restrictions — the actual date is undetermined, according to Jessie Moore, of the Gilmer County UGA Extension Office.

“We do not have a definite date at this time,” Moore said. “We are working with the university and local officials to determine the best course of action for this year’s market, given the COVID-19 pandemic. It is our hope to have a plan soon.”

Williamson added, “We encourage individuals to find out more about our vendors so that between now and opening they can deal directly with the vendors.”
